Postmaster supported the Word Services Suite, which allowed its text
to be checked and corrected by grammar and spelling checkers such as
Working Software's Spellswell, which I ported to BeOS from Mac OS.

On Mac OS, Word Services is based on Apple Events.  On BeOS it's based
on BMessages.
